Курсовая работа: Аппроксимация функции методом наименьших квадратов
End;
Function FI( i ,k : integer): real;
Begin
if i=1 then FI:=1;
if i=2 then FI:=Sin(x[k]);
if i=3 then FI:=Cos(x[k]);
End;
Procedure PEREST(i:integer;var a:mass1;var b:mass2);
begin
big:=0;
num:=0;
for l:= i to 3 do
if abs(a[l,i]) > big then
begin
big:=a[l,i]; writeln ( big:6:4);
num:=l;
end;
if big=0 then
writeln('Перестановкауравнений');
if num<>i then
for j:=i to 3 do
begin
temp:=a[i,j];
a[i,j]:=a[num,j];
a[num,j]:=temp;
end;
temp:=b[i];
b[i]:=b[num];
b[num]:=temp;